Unhappy

英式发音:[n'hp] or [n'hpi] 美式发音

    (adj.) experiencing or marked by or causing sadness or sorrow or discontent; 'unhappy over her departure'; 'unhappy with her raise'; 'after the argument they lapsed into an unhappy silence'; 'had an unhappy time at school'; 'the unhappy (or sad) news'; 'he looks so sad' .

    (adj.) causing discomfort; 'the unhappy truth' .
